PillProof (“we,” “our,” or “us”) is committed to protecting your privacy. This Privacy Policy explains how your information is handled when you use the PillProof mobile application.
We operate on a “Privacy by Design” philosophy: your health data belongs to you and stays under your control. PillProof is funded through app purchases, allowing us to operate without advertising or selling user data.
PillProof is designed as a privacy-first app. Your data stays on your device unless you choose to use iCloud backups or Caregiver Sharing (CloudKit).
All medication schedules, logs, notes, and history are stored locally on your device or within your personal iCloud storage (if device backups are enabled). We do not have access to this data.
Photos and videos recorded as proof of medication intake are stored directly on your device’s local file system. We do not upload or access these files.
If you choose to share your medication history with a caregiver, PillProof uses Apple CloudKit to securely sync selected history records—including optional photo or video proofs—with the invited caregiver.
PillProof does not operate external servers for storing medication history, photos, videos, or health information. We cannot view or access your personal data.
PillProof does not create user accounts or collect personal profiles.
You voluntarily enter medication names, dosages, schedules, and notes. This information remains on your device.
PillProof requests access to the Camera and Microphone only to allow you to record video proofs or voice memos related to medication intake.
To help you add medications more easily, PillProof uses a public API provided by the U.S. National Library of Medicine (NIH / RxTerms).
PillProof does not use analytics, advertising SDKs, or cross-app tracking.
